In order to maintain a safe and secure environment for the students, faculty and staff of Mills College, the Department of Public Safety needs your help! Our "See Something, Say Something" campaign enlists students, staff, faculty and the Mills community to report any suspicious behavior.
We can all help prevent crime by being aware of our surroundings and the behaviors of others. If you see something, say something. If you are on campus, alert a campus safety staff member or college official. If you are off campus, alert the local police department.
Report anyone behaving suspiciously:
* Someone shouting "HELP" or "FIRE";
* Someone unfamiliar to you loitering on campus grounds or near pedestrian entrances to campus and that person doesn't appear to have any legitimate purpose for being there;
* Anyone forcibly breaking into and entering a car.
* Anyone carrying a weapon.
* Someone behaving in a way that makes you uneasy or nervous.
Follow these steps when contacting security, law enforcement and medical service providers:
* Remain calm.
* Dial 911 from any home, business, or pay phone. From a Cell Phone dial the Oakland Police Department ( OPD) at (510) 777-3211. The Oakland Police Department Non-Emergency Number is (510) 777-3333.
* Notify Public Safety or your 911 call. (510-430-5555)
* Identify yourself (name, address, and phone number) and give your location.
* Describe what is happening or what you saw happen.
* If there is a suspect or vehicle involved, provide the police dispatcher with a detailed description and the direction the suspect/vehicle is travelling in."
